Our practice also embarked on a program with the United States Military known as the SkillBridge Program. Designed by the military, this program helps military personnel embarking on a life away from their branch in the private sector as a civilian. Qualified industry companies adopt approved candidates for training in the career industry of their choice.



These companies are given between 90 to 120 days to train these military persons and prepare them for their next steps as a civilian. Currently Pets R Family Veterinary Hospital is the only approved veterinary practice in the United States. We are honored to offer these amazing people who have served our country well by serving them in our mentorship training program, as they embark on the next chapter of their lives.
